Android数据库开发助手_SQLite ORM库,高效简化编程体验
大家好,今天我们邀请到了张晓,一位资深的Android应用开发者,来为我们介绍一款专为Android操作系统设计的SQLite数据库对象关系映射(ORM)工具库。这款工具库不仅简化了数据库操作流程,还实现了自动化的表结构创建与版本升级功能,大大提高了数据库开发效率。接下来,我们将一起探讨如何在Android Studio中引用这个库并执行基本的增删改查(CRUD)操作。
在移动应用开发领域,SQLite因其轻量级、高性能以及易于集成的特性而被广泛应用。然而,直接操作SQL语句既繁琐又容易出错。ORM技术应运而生,它将对象模型与关系型数据库之间的数据进行转换,让开发者可以面向对象地操作数据库,无需直接编写SQL语句。对于Android平台来说,一个优秀的SQLite ORM工具库不仅简化了数据库操作,还能提高开发效率,减少错误。
随着移动应用复杂度的增加,高效且可靠的数据库管理变得尤为重要。ORM工具库在Android平台的应用场景非常广泛,它能在开发初期快速搭建数据库模型,自动生成表结构,帮助开发者更快地投入业务逻辑实现。在应用维护过程中,ORM工具库能自动处理版本迁移问题,确保数据的一致性和完整性。ORM提供了简洁易用的API接口,使得CRUD等基本操作变得直观高效。
张晓建议,在集成SQLite ORM工具库之前,首先确保开发环境已安装最新版本的Android Studio。为了将ORM工具库集成到项目中,开发者需要遵循一系列步骤,包括在build.gradle文件中添加依赖项、同步Gradle项目、创建实体类、初始化数据库以及执行CRUD操作。
ORM工具库的配置同样关键。数据库版本控制、实体类设计、查询优化等方面都需要开发者注意。例如,数据库版本控制需要指定版本号,ORM工具库会自动处理版本迁移;实体类设计要合理,避免过度复杂的继承关系或关联关系;查询优化可以通过预编译SQL语句或使用索引来提高查询速度。
最后,张晓还分享了ORM工具库的高级查询功能,如多条件组合查询、分页查询、联合查询与子查询等,以及性能优化和内存管理策略。她强调,通过掌握正确的技巧和方法,即使是复杂的数据库操作也能变得简单高效。
通过本文的介绍,相信大家对SQLite ORM工具库有了更深入的了解,也学会了如何在实际开发中应用这一工具。无论是初学者还是经验丰富的开发者,都能从中受益,提升自己的开发技能,创造出更加高效且可靠的应用程序。接下来,让我们一起听听张晓的详细讲解。